Transaction 51a665e43ea9cc6acc1a5b9fe30196c5c826b7f8480768310b1aea93adbe66a4

1 Input
2 Outputs
  • 51a665e43ea9cc6acc1a5b9fe30196c5c826b7f8480768310b1aea93adbe66a4:0
  • value  490986627926
    address  2N5dXkyTrXiVAh8Ak7SxwMaePDUkwnpV2JC
  • 51a665e43ea9cc6acc1a5b9fe30196c5c826b7f8480768310b1aea93adbe66a4:1
  • value  17048154
    address  2NBMEX82kcaScGs9AGwENDfvCDV6fvhCLJz